The U.S. Embassy Ankara required the supply and Category 3 release-ready handover of three (3) brand-new, factory-produced MY2026 or newer C-segment compact sport utility vehicles (SUVs) for official all-weather transportation and mission-support use. The RFQ described the requirement through brand-neutral salient characteristics and did not require a specific make or model.
The awarded product is the technically accepted configuration proposed by Baytur: three MY2026 Subaru Forester 2.0i Mild Hybrid Style vehicles, Türkiye/EU-market, left-hand drive, automatic, all-wheel drive, with manufacturer-backed in-country warranty and authorized Subaru service and parts support.
Award was made under the RFQ's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) method. Technical acceptability was pass/fail. No tradeoff, best-technical ranking, or extra credit for exceeding minimum requirements was applied. The Contracting Officer retained price evaluation, responsibility determination, and final award authority.
This award synopsis was prepared for SAM.gov/FPDS award-abstract support and contract-file transparency. The underlying decision was based on the RFQ, the final TEP report, the Contracting Officer's price and responsibility determinations, and the simplified acquisition/LPTA framework. Proprietary quotation content and individual unsuccessful-quoter findings remain in the acquisition file.
